The motoscope mini with ABE is an extremely small, digital motorcycle instrument. The LED display developed specifically for this purpose is unique in the instrument sector. 251 ultra-bright LEDs form a nearly borderless, excellently readable display area that can be used entirely to show display values. Only this innovative, sophisticated technology allows for a maximum display area while maintaining minimal housing dimensions.
Thanks to its very simple, elegant design and high-quality appearance, the motoscope mini fits almost any two-, three-, or four-wheeled vehicle. It can support the styling in an exposed position, but can also be integrated in an unobtrusive and 'clean' way - the mini makes everything possible!
The housing:
The high-quality aluminum housing is machined from a solid block and its surface is black anodized. The high-gloss polished version has its own appeal. The electronics are completely potted in the housing and are therefore immune to weather, water, dust, and vibration.
Display and functions:
The innovative dot matrix of 251 ultra-bright LEDs displays the RPM via a scalable, horizontal light band and all other functions as numerical values that are easy to read. The RPM can also be called up as a numerical value at the push of a button. To achieve optimal readability in darkness, sunlight, and twilight, the brightness of the LEDs is adjusted automatically. For the limit range of the permissible RPM ('red zone') or as a shift light function, an RPM value can be entered, upon exceeding which all LEDs flash simultaneously.
The highlight: the display of the motoscope mini can show numerical values not only from left to right, but also from top to bottom. Therefore, the instrument can also be mounted vertically!
Operation:
The included menu button or, for example, the headlight flasher button on the handlebar is used to switch between the displays. The standard display on the screen is the speed value. The other measured values can be brought onto the display if required by a short press of the button. Optionally, it can be set so that the display automatically returns to the speed value after a short time or that a specific display is permanently set. Presets or saved values naturally remain stored even without a power supply.
Mounting:
Due to its very small dimensions, the motoscope mini is easy to attach almost anywhere on any vehicle. Standing alone on the triple clamp or handlebar, in existing instrument panels, or embedded in the tank or fiberglass - the instrument can be integrated anywhere.
Connection and sensors:
Simple wiring as well as detailed installation and operating instructions make connecting the instrument possible even for users who have not previously dealt with vehicle electronics. The included stainless steel speedometer sensor is very small (M5/25 mm). With the 1.5 m long connection cable, it can be easily attached to the front or rear wheel. Vehicles with an original mechanical speedometer drive can also be easily converted with it. The motoscope mini is compatible with many original speedometer sensors (reed contact and proximity sensors) from vehicle manufacturers. In this case, only connections need to be made, and the mechanical installation of a sensor becomes unnecessary. An intelligent 'teach function' allows for easy calibration of the speedometer - even on vehicles with sensors on the transmission.
Technical data and functions:
Length/width/depth: 59 mm/21.5 mm/13 mm
Weight: approx. 32 g
Mounting: 2 x M3 threaded bushing
Power consumption during operation: approx. 100 mA
Operating voltage: 7 V - 18 V
Operating temperature: -20° +80°C
Tachometer (LED bar) = 0 – 6/ 8/ 10/ 14/ 16 krpm
Tachometer (numeric) = 0 – 20 krpm
Limit range setting/shift light = 0 – 20,000 rpm
Speedometer = 0 – 999 km/h or mph
Trip odometer = 0 – 999.99 km or mi
Total distance (adjustable) = up to 99,999 km or mi
Trip time display = 0 – 99:59 h/min

Attention: When converting the BMW 2-valve boxer electrical system to a different speedometer, the original charge indicator light is usually omitted or replaced by an LED.
In this case, a resistor must be installed instead of the lamp, otherwise the battery will not be charged.
This resistor can be used with all SE wiring harnesses as well as with the original wiring harness.
